The Gallery offers schools an imaginative and magical educational experience. Aimed at Key Stage 1 and 2, the interactive displays encourage pupils to investigate history, natural history, science and technology through practical hands-on activities relating to museum objects.
Curriculum Links (English and Science):
- Participate in discussions, presentations, performances role play / improvisations
- Appreciate our rich and varied literary heritage
- Use discussion in order to learn; they should be able to elaborate and explain clearly their understanding and ideas
- Ask simple questions and recognise that they can be answered in different ways
- Observe closely, using simple equipment
In a typical 90-minute sessions pupils will:
- Hear about Roald Dahl’s stories, his life and his inspiration
- Act out a scene from Charlie and the Chocolate Factory
- Investigate underground treasures in Fantastic Mr Fox’s Tunnel
- Discover the world of minibeasts inside James’s Giant Peach
- Explore sound with the BFG
- Baffle your brains and boggle your eyes with optical illusions
- Shrink in Mr Wonka’s Chocolate Television Machine
